Detection of Enterovirus D68 in Wastewater Samples from the UK between July and November 2021

Alison Tedcastle et al.

Summary: In recent years, infections with enterovirus D68 (EV-D68) have been associated with severe neurological diseases such as acute flaccid myelitis (AFM). However, there is a lack of active surveillance for EV-D68, making it difficult to fully assess this association. The authors observed an increase in EV-D68 detections in wastewater samples from the United Kingdom between July and November 2021, reflecting a rise in EV-D68 detections in clinical samples from various European countries. This study provides the first publicly available 2021 EV-D68 sequences, showing the co-circulation of EV-D68 strains from genetic clade D and sub-clade B3 as in previous years. The results highlight the value of environmental surveillance for early detection of circulating and clinically relevant human viruses.

Sustained detection of type 2 poliovirus in London sewage between February and July, 2022, by enhanced environmental surveillance

Dimitra Klapsa et al.

Summary: Environmental surveillance in London identified genetically linked poliovirus isolates related to the Sabin vaccine strain, with an increasing proportion meeting the criteria for vaccine-derived poliovirus. Whole-genome sequencing confirmed transmission of a unique recombinant poliovirus lineage, now detected in Israel and the USA.

Molecular Epidemiology and Evolutionary Trajectory of Emerging Echovirus 30, Europe

Kimberley S. M. Benschop et al.

Summary: In 2018, there was an upsurge of echovirus 30 (E30) infections reported in Europe, with most cases affecting individuals aged 0-4 and 25-34. A large-scale study of 1,329 E30 strains collected in 22 European countries from 2016 to 2018 revealed that the majority belonged to genetic clades G1 and G6, each with unique recombinant forms. The rapid turnover of new clades and recombinant forms occurred over time, and by 2018, clades G1 and G6 dominated the E30 outbreak, indicating the emergence of two distinct circulating clades in Europe.
